8 Mizoram health centres ranked among India’s best government hospitals

Aizawl, June 16 (UNI) Eight government health facilities from Mizoram have been newly ranked among the best-performing public hospitals in India under the National Quality Assurance Standards (NQAS).
According to Dr Lily Chhakchhuak, Mission Director of the National Health Mission under the Health & Family Welfare Department, the newly accredited facilities include Kawnpui PHC (91.42%), Pangzawl PHC (96.26%), Chhingchhip PHC (93.80%), Hrangchalkawn UPHC (93.35%), Lungsen PHC (88.22%), Cherhlun PHC (89.66%), Sangau PHC (89.03%), and Chhuarlung PHC (95.30%).
With the latest recognition, Mizoram now has 19 Primary Health Centres (PHCs) and 3 Urban Primary Health Centres (UPHCs) holding the prestigious NQAS national certification. Additionally, 12 more government health facilities that have already earned state-level certification are currently undergoing the process for national-level assessment.
